Listing to 'Matthewdavid' is like looking at a Matthew Furie illustration. You get the basic idea but there's so much more beneath the surface. 'MD' is an excellent lo-fi, geek hop act from LA. Unlike many of 'MD's' peers, he manages to incorporate soothing mixes of ho's and hum's to make some of the most blissed out songs to date. "First_Day_Rmxd," originally a Dntel track, is a mash of all things that make 'MD' great. Booms, clicks, whistles all culminate to create one exquisite piece of work. Eternal Summers
The other day is was going through ye ol' email and was pleasantly surprised when I discovered 'RR's' buddy's 'Eternal Summers' had sent me a promo for their aw-inspiring self titled EP. The sound is best described as a refreshing take on the summery, dream pop that we've all been used to lately. "Fall Straight Back," my favorite song off their new EP, is a balmy, blissed out masterpiece which perfectly showcase Nichols amazing vocals and Daniel's chill drum style. Assassins 88
I've got some more noise-ish, lo-fi for you guys today. It's from the amazing Aussie duo 'Assassins 88.' I just found out about these guys from a buddy the other day and managed to get my hands on their first release, "Go Go Second Chance Virgin." The whole album is great but there is one song that was just amazing. The song is called "Age of Consent," Listen I don't know what these guys used to record this but it's bloody terrific. Screaming guitar and a massive drum part set up the song, which is shortly followed by crazy distorted vocals.
